Ingram gave me ETAs of November 1 for product, and it’s hard to run a business with that kind of delay, or to bring it in inventory and then get punished by a customer because their unit sat on my shelf for 6 months. I dont want to eat half the warranty period when it’s stocked on my shelf before it’s deployed. When I want it in stock, it is for my own business needs as an integrator. My customers would laugh at me and find someone else if I told them it’s 6 months for product availability. I can appreciate why they’re asking, but is there that much greymarket sold in the US?
